    I've come here a few times and food is always great and consistent! Prices are reasonable and they are always cleaning the stations. The food is always fresh tasting and hot. They always keep it refilled and stocked--however I've only come for lunch time so I'm not sure how they run dinner. Service is typical, you order your drink and get to eating. They refill drinks, take dirty plates away in a timely manner and when you get dessert, they give the check plus a fortune cookie. Plenty of parking and they are usually busy during lunch.

    Hibachi Buffet and Grill is a spacious eatery providing an all-you-can-eat Asian buffet, with sushi, a grill station and seafood. A family oriented establishment. I like the place and it is what it is. If a place is always busy, it must be serving good food and I must say, this place has good food. There is a good selection of food and meat options. Some of it is better than others and it isn't fancy. It is not the finest food, but it has a good value. You can choose your own ingredients for soups. Salads and fruits were fresh and delicious. They had ice cream when you dine in which I liked a lot. The sushi is good and the pieces are very large and tasty. Fried oysters, shrimp cooked about ten different ways. You can get stir-fry with seafood. The hibachi is good too. I liked that I was able to build my own plate and watch the guy cook it for me. The servers were good, they had a bit of a crowd so it was understandable if they were a bit slow with our drinks. Our service was okay, but I don't expect much from a buffet waitress. They do have ample free parking in front of the restaurant. I would recommend this place to give at least a try and you would not be disappointed. I would be sure going back again.

    My family loves eating at Asian buffets so off we went for lunch. It was around $13 + tax/tip per…read moreperson for lunch which I thought was pretty good. The front has plenty of parking. What really surprised me was not only did they have a hibachi station but they also had a pho/noodle bar station too. You pick the ingredients you want - vegetables, protein, noodles, toppings, etc. and then you bring it (to the hibachi person!) and you tell them which broth you want. They drop the ingredients in a broth to cook them and then put all the stuff into the broth of your choice. I actually thought the pho I got was not bad. The broth was surprisingly decent with a good amount of flavor, and I would have definitely considered getting this at a regular restaurant too. I thought the rest of the food was also not bad, rather standard Asian buffets offerings like Americanized Chinese food (orange chicken), fried rice, lo mein, etc. They also had a lot of desserts like jello, cheesecake, and there is a separate cooler for some ice cream cups. The ice cream was very strange, a bit milky and didn't really melt after awhile which was a bit concerning...
